"As expected... that damned Inferno stench..."

The Tidebreaker, Paxton, stood tall, his face grim and fierce, eyes flashing with a sharp, deadly light. He locked his gaze onto the figure striding toward them through the roaring flas—Efreet hero Azrak—followed by an army of 11th-Tier Efreets and 12th-Tier Efreet Sultans. His aura exploded outward, thick with killing intent.

"...What a terrifying presence..."

Azrak’s expression darkened the mont he felt Paxton’s overwhelming aura. A shadow flickered across his eyes.

"A mage-type hero... Wait a second, this Infernal Lord Malphas...?"

Ethan muttered, his eyes suddenly flashing with realization. His heart skipped a beat as a mory surfaced.

Back in the Unicorn Duchy, there was that Infernal Lord whose power had been suppressed by the World Will of the main world—and Ethan had killed him once.

That guy’s na... was Malphas too, wasn’t it?

No way it’s just a coincidence, right?

"Malphas is here too?" Ethan asked sharply.

Azrak froze for a second, then sneered.

"What, getting scared? Don’t worry—soon, the wrath of my great lord Malphas will consu every last one of you!"

"Infernal Lord Malphas? Shit... it’s really him?"

Paxton’s face darkened, his expression turning grim.

Clearly, he knew exactly who Malphas was—and he wasn’t happy about it.

"So it really is him... No wonder this mission was rated S difficulty," Ethan muttered under his breath.

"A sixty-eight or sixty-nine-level Infernal Lord... that’s not gonna be easy to deal with."

He rembered clearly—when he first encountered Malphas, the guy had been level 70.

Ethan had managed to kill him back then, but that was when Malphas was weakened, his power suppressed by the World Will—basically a half-crippled state.

Now, though?

Now Malphas would be at full strength.

If Ethan had to guess, Malphas was probably back at his peak—and his current power level wouldn’t be any lower than Crimsonstar Kingdom’s ace hero, Thalric...

This was bad.

Really bad.

But—

Ethan’s eyes glead as he stared at the Efreet, Azrak.

"But maybe... this is our shot."

Honestly, if Azrak had already linked up with Infernal Lord Malphas, even with The Tidebreaker Paxton at his side, Ethan knew they’d have no choice but to turn tail and run for their lives.

But right now?

It was just Azrak.

And he was the weakest one.

This was practically a gift-wrapped opportunity!

"Paxton," Ethan said quickly, keeping his back to Azrak and shooting Paxton a aningful look, "we need to take him out—fast. If he links up with Malphas, we’re screwed."

Paxton, a seasoned general of the Storm Kingdom, caught on imdiately.

He gave Ethan a quick wink, his eyes narrowing sharply—and then he moved.

"Let’s go!"

BOOM!

With a roar that shook the heavens, The Tidebreaker Paxton unleashed a terrifying surge of power. His entire body ignited with a blazing, almost fla-like aura, and he shot toward Azrak like a bolt of lightning.

In his hands, a massive silver warhamr materialized—

—and he brought it crashing down with devastating force!

At the sa ti, hundreds of warriors materialized behind him:

11th-Tier Naga Swordsn, 12th-Tier Naga Swordmasters, and even 13th-Tier Kirins, all summoned by Paxton’s call, charging straight at the enemy lines!

The battlefield exploded into chaos in an instant.

Azrak reacted fast—

blazing backward at a speed more than twice Paxton’s.

That was his survival strategy.

As a mage-type elental hero, Azrak was fragile as hell in close combat—one good hit and he was toast.

But he was fast.

And his magic? Absolutely devastating.

In other words, if he could just put so distance between them and get enough breathing room to cast—

it would be the beginning of the end for his enemies.

Azrak darted back, narrowly dodging Paxton’s hamr strike,

and imdiately began chanting under his breath.

BOOM!

In the blink of an eye, a massive surge of fire magic erupted around him, roaring like a tidal wave.

The air itself seed to boil as the infernal energy gathered, swirling around Azrak at the center like a living storm.

At the sa ti, a terrifying pressure radiated from him, crackling like a thunderstorm—

so intense it made the heart tremble.

"Face the judgnt of the damned!"

Azrak roared.

"Inferno Flas!"

With a deafening howl, the Efreet unleashed his ultimate area-of-effect spell—

and the battlefield was about to be swallowed whole in fire.

...

But right at that mont—

everything changed.

Whoosh!

Out of nowhere, a golden dragon claw tore through the air, slashing straight into Efreet Azrak with brutal force.

In an instant, Azrak was ripped from the sky and slamd into the ground like a teor, crashing down with a deafening boom!

His spell?

Completely disrupted—gone.
